tlg2300: fix missing check for audio creation
Commit Message
From: Alan Cox <alan@linux.intel.com>
If we fail to set up the capture device we go through negative indexes and
badness happens. Add the missing test.
Resolves-bug: https://bugzilla.kernel.org/show_bug.cgi?id=44551
Signed-off-by: Alan Cox <alan@linux.intel.com>
---
drivers/media/usb/tlg2300/pd-alsa.c | 4 ++++
1 file changed, 4 insertions(+)

That patch broke compilation:
CC drivers/media/usb/tlg2300/pd-alsa.o
drivers/media/usb/tlg2300/pd-alsa.c: In function 'poseidon_audio_init':
drivers/media/usb/tlg2300/pd-alsa.c:309:3: error: implicit declaration of function 'snd_free_card' [-Werror=implicit-function-declaration]
This change fixed it:
- snd_free_card(card);
+ snd_card_free(card);
Not sure if this is a typo, or if it is due to some function rename
that might be happening at alsa subsystem and you might be noticed
at -next. In any case, I had to apply a patch on my tree fixing it.
